Abstract:
A chuck is provided with a body, a plurality of jaws and an adjustment ring. The adjustment ring is threadably engaged with the jaws. When the adjustment ring is rotated in one direction, the jaws tighten by moving closer to each other. When the adjustment ring is rotated in the opposite direction, the jaws loosen by moving away from each other. An impact member is also provided for engagement with the adjustment ring. When the drive shaft of the power tool is rotated, the adjustment ring impacts against the impact member. As a result, the adjustment ring and the body of the chuck rotate relative to each other causing the jaws of the chuck to loosen or tighten depending on the direction the drive shaft is rotating.
Abstract:
A signal transmission cable is adapted to pass through a hinge assembly and includes a flexible circuit substrate. A first connection section is formed at a first end of the flexible circuit substrate and has a plurality of signal transmission lines provided thereon. A second connection section is formed at a second end of the flexible circuit substrate and has a plurality of signal transmission lines provided thereon. The cable further has a cluster section formed on the flexible circuit substrate between the first and the second connection sections, and has a plurality of signal transmission lines provided thereon to respectively connect at two ends to the signal transmission lines on the first and the second connection sections. The cluster section includes a plurality of clustered flat cables formed by cutting the flexible circuit substrate along a plurality of parallel cutting lines extended in the lengthwise direction of the flexible circuit substrate.
Abstract:
An apparatus and method for cell acquisition and downlink synchronization acquisition in an OFDMA wireless communication system are provided. In an SS apparatus in a broadband wireless communication system, a preamble subcarrier acquirer extracts subcarrier values having a preamble code from an FFT signal. A multiplier code-demodulates the subcarrier values by multiplying the subcarrier values by a preamble code. A correlator calculates a plurality of differential correlations in the code-demodulated signal. An IFFT processor IFFT-processes the differential correlations by mapping the differential correlations to subcarriers. A maximum value detector detects a maximum value from the IFFT signal and calculates a timing offset using an IFFT output index having the maximum value.
Abstract:
A rigid-flex PCB includes at least one rigid PCB (RPCB) and at least one flexible PCB (FPCB). Each RPCB has a connection section; first and second sections separately extended from two lateral edges of the connection section and having at least one FPCB bonding side each; and a weakening structure formed along each joint of the connection section and the first and second sections. Each FPCB has a bending section corresponding to the connection section on the RPCB; first and second sections separately extended from two lateral edges of the bending section and having at least one RPCB bonding side each corresponding to the FPCB bonding sides of the first and second sections of the RPCB. When a proper pressure is applied against the weakening structures, the RPCB may be easily bent broken at the weakening structures to remove the connection section therefrom.
Abstract:
An apparatus and a method for driving the light source of a projector are provided. The apparatus includes an adjustment unit, a lamp driver, a phase lock loop (PLL) and a mercury lamp. The adjustment unit provides an enabling signal and regulates the frequency of the enabling signal according to an indication signal. The lamp driver provides a driving signal according to the enabling signal and an input voltage, wherein the frequency of the driving signal is varied with the frequency of the enabling signal. The PLL provides a synchronized driving signal according to the driving signal and a vertical synchronization signal, wherein the synchronized driving signal is phase-synchronous with the frame field of the projector. The mercury lamp serves as the light source of the projector according to the synchronized driving signal.
